Hi Jeremy,Thanks, your suggestion is good.What I used to do with Sage 300 was the following:Use an Excel Amortization Schedule for each mortgage loan (payable and receivable) that calculated the P+I amounts for the term of the loan.In a separate tab, build an import layout for the year’s payments. Open all the fiscal periods for the current fiscal year, then import all payments for all months in the year. Sage 300 is batch-based, so I would just post the batch into the current and future periods. Finally, close / lock the future periods.For monthly loan payments that were fixed principal + interest at a variable rate, I would set up a recurring entry, but leave the interest distribution amount as $0.00. When the payment cleared the bank, or when I received the payment notification from the lender, I edited the interest distribution for the correct interest then posted.I can do the same in Acumatica. I have a client that wants to do the same thing - use the Mobile App on an iPad, take a picture of a shipment package contents with the iPad and then upload the picture file to the shipment. The ability to attached / upload files to Quotes and Sales Orders is there, but it is not available on a Shipment.I found another Community posting where it was suggested to take the picture with the iPad, then switch to / login to the Acumatica ERP via the browser, open the shipment and then use the Files option to select and upload the picture from the iPad (don’t have the post reference - If I can find it again, I’ll post it here). This works but is counter-intuitive to using the mobile app.

My client just upgraded from 2020R2 to 2022R1. They asked me the exact same question - how to change the default setting of ‘Recalculate Unit Prices’ from checked (True) to unchecked (false) in the Copy To dialog box.They are copying from a Quote to a Sales Order. Quote prices are valid for 30 days from quote issue.When the client accepts and signs back quote, my client does not want the unit prices changing from quote to sales order when the sales rep uses the COPY ORDER function to open the Copy To dialog box. their preference is to have the option to Recalculate Unit Prices, but default it as unchecked.This should be a configuration setting somewhere in the Sales Order Preferences or on the Order Type settings.

@mpowell,I can think of three possible ways of applying a 2.5% charge to the item or the invoice.Set your sell price at $102.50, i.e. the credit card price. Set up a discount for 2.439024% to be applied to cash sales. Assign the discount to cash customers.In this case, on a sales order without the discount the unit sell will be $102.50. With the discount the unit sell will be $100.00. The 2.5% “fee” for paying by credit card will not be tracked separately.Enter a negative discount percent on the line item(s). This will then calculate as a negative discount amount and be added to the line item price.In this case, on a sales order without the -2.5% discount the unit sell will be $100.00. With the -2.5% discount the unit sell will be $102.50. The 2.5% “fee” for paying by credit card will not be tracked separately.
